- 博客(27)
- 收藏
- 关注
原创 npm命令
npm install (依赖包名称) -S(或-D):安装依赖包(-S(全称--save)明确进入dependencies节点,-D(全称--save-dev)明确进入devDependencies节点;npm uninstall 依赖名称 -g:删除全局的指定依赖。npm install -g npm@版本号:更新至~版本。npm uninstall 依赖包名称:删除指定的依赖包。npm cache clean --force:清除缓存。npm init -y:初始化包管理配置文件。
2023-03-29 22:09:18 382
原创 定时器效果(实现打开一个网页一段时间后自动跳转到另一个网页)(感应灯效果)
以此,我们可以利用它实现一个感应灯的效果,即当点击按钮时,灯自动亮起,三秒后自动熄灭。(也可点击按钮熄灭)相关要点:定时器window.setTimeout(调用函数,延时时间)打开一个网页一段时间后(自定义)自动跳转到另一个网页。即打开一个网页一秒后自动跳转到指定的另一个网页。window在调用时可省略)
2024-09-19 22:07:47 331
原创 arguments的简单使用
arguments:类数组对象,可进行参数储存,其属性名按照传入参数的序列来。eg:传入的第一个参数的属性名为“0”,传入的第二个参数的属性名为“1”,传入的第三个参数的属性名为“2”......以此类推。且它还具有length属性,存储的为传入参数的个数。实例:输出(2, 4, 7, 1, 29, 46, 93, 30, 57, 100)中的最大值。相关要点:遍历数组。
2024-09-18 22:27:15 234
原创 CSS实现天体旋转
主要运用了animation动画,使地球进行自转,月球进行公转,效果如下(GIF动图有点大,传不进来),地球自己在旋转,月球围绕地球进行旋转。
2023-05-11 14:27:38 786
原创 Vue实现推箱子游戏
使用Vue实现推箱子游戏与使用JS实现推箱子游戏的不同之处在于,Vue要在实例化中添加一个事件监听来监听键盘,而JS则是直接对整个页面使用onkeyup直接监听。
2023-05-09 23:04:17 493 1
原创 JS实现推箱子游戏
使用JS制作推箱子游戏主要是使用了键盘的监听事件(onkeyup,onkeydown,onkeypress),它们的不同点在于:onkeyup是按键按下去然后抬起的时候触发事件;onkeydown是按键按下去时就触发事件;onkeypress是按键按下去且产生了字符时触发事件,这里我们主要使用onkeyup。
2023-04-24 23:35:52 898
原创 webpack配置使用(自动打包)
在书写代码时,我们会发现有些浏览器并不支持某些高级语法,此时我们则需要寻找适配的其他语句,比较麻烦。而这时我们就可以用webpack来使代码自动转化为适配绝大多数浏览器的语句。
2023-03-29 21:33:54 556
原创 webpack打包指定文件到指定位置
在不做设置的情况下,webpack会默认处理src文件夹下面的index.html文件,处理完成后会自动默认新建一个dist目录,并将生成的默认文件main.js存入里面,但当我们改变html文件名字后,webpack将无法进行运行打包,此时我们需要设置需要打包的具体文件。
2023-03-29 18:39:04 2454
原创 简易ATM(js)
<!DOCTYPE html><html><head> <meta http-equiv="Content-Type" content="text/html;charset=UTF-8" /> <title></title> <script>//银行卡初始余额 var balance = 100 do { var num = prompt( '请输入您要进
2023-03-05 22:36:40 100 1
原创 计算器(个位数运算,js实现)
<!DOCTYPE html><html><head> <meta http-equiv="Content-Type" content="text/html;charset=UTF-8" /> <title></title> <style> #jisuanqi { width: 500px; border: 2px solid #ccc; margin: 0
2023-03-03 21:27:53 93 2
使用Vue实现推箱子游戏
2023-05-11
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人